Incorporated in 2008 through the merger of the former Reiffton and Stonersville Fire Companies, the Exeter Township Fire Department is a combination volunteer and paid department that serves Exeter Township, Berks County, Pennsylvania. Operating from two stations, the department averages approximately 1000 calls for service annually. The ETFD first-due area consists of twenty-six square miles of suburban and rural environments including rivers, fields, lakes, mountains, strip malls, dairy farms, single family homes, apartments, 4-lane highways, dirt lanes, and everything in between. The ETFD operates three engine/rescue pumpers, one rural tanker, one tower ladder, and a variety of utility, brush, all terrain, and marine units. A comprehensive staffing program ensures firefighters are on-duty around the clock.
